Zac Rinaldo

Zac Rinaldo ( born June 15, 1990 in Mississauga, Ontario ) is a Canadian professional ice hockey player. Since 2011 he plays for the Philadelphia Flyers of the National Hockey League for the position of right winger.

Career

Zac Rinaldo was from the 2007/ 08 squad to the root of the Ontario Hockey League clubs Mississauga St. Michael's Majors, where he soon distinguished himself by his physical game. NHL Entry Draft 2008, the Canadian was selected in the sixth round to total 178 position of the Philadelphia Flyers. After a total of 107 games for the St. Michael's Majors Rinaldo was transferred to the London Knights 6 January 2009 in exchange for Kale Kerbashian. The winger completed in the regular season of OHL 2008/ 09 56 games, but he received 201 penalty minutes; more than any other player in the OHL.

On 11 August 2009 Zac Rinaldo signed an entry-level contract with the Flyers. After 34 appearances for the Knights in the season 2009 /10 of the striker 9 January 2010 was transferred in exchange for Chris DeSousa to the Barrie Colts. Rinaldo finished the season 2009/10 a total of 255 penalty minutes and was as last season the most frequently punished players the Ontario Hockey League. In the 2010/11 season of the American Hockey League, the player belonged to the permanent staff of Philadelphia's farm team Adirondack Phantoms. Rinaldo presented at the end of the season with 331 penalty minutes a team-internal record; the league had this season only Pierre- Luc Létourneau - Leblond with 334 penalty minutes a higher number. After the end of the regular season AHL he was nominated for two NHL play-off games in the cadre of Philadelphia Flyers.

After five appearances for the Flyers at the start of the NHL season 2011/12 Rinaldo was sent back to the Phantoms. The winger completed four games for Philadelphia's AHL farm team, before he was appointed back in the NHL squad. As a result, Rinaldo earned a regular place in the squad of the Philadelphia Flyers. Even in the NHL remained Zac Rinaldo his hard play and faithful gathered in the 66 games that he came in the regular season for use, 232 penalty minutes. He was punished in the second Commonly players of the National Hockey League behind Derek Dorsett. In addition, he received 48 penalty minutes in five playoff games. In addition, Rinaldo was locked in his rookie season in the NHL on February 13, 2012 after a foul against Jonathan Ericsson check from the league for two games.
